The Smart Key permits or denies the passive

access to the vehicle based on the received RSSI

and security validation. Passive key facilitates the

user to access the vehicle without actively using

the key fob ensuring comfort and security. Smart

Key consist of 4 buttons namely lock, unlock,

tailgate unlock and approach lamp button.

1. Vehicle Unlock Operation

When Vehicle is in locked condition and user

presses unlock button on Smart Key, all doors gets

unlocked. After successful unlock, flasher

indication comes ON once.

2. Vehicle Lock Operation

When vehicle is in unlocked condition and all doors

are closed and user presses the lock button on

Smart Key, Vehicle gets centrally locked. After

successful lock, flasher indication comes ON twice.

After unsuccessful lock, reverse unlock happens in

case of driver door ajar condition and slam lock

happens in case of other door ajar condition with

mis-lock sound.

3. Approach Light Operation

Approach light ON operation:

When vehicle is in OFF mode (ACC, IGN and

Crank are OFF) and user presses the Approach

Light button on Smart Key, Approach lights (Low

beam, position lamps and roof lamp) turns ON.

Approach light OFF operation:

When user presses the Approach Light button

again if approach lamps are ON OR Approach

lamp timer elapses Approach Light turns OFF.

NOTE

Tailgate cannot be locked using tailgate button

on Smart Key.

If smart key battery is low/drained or vehicle

battery is low/drained, user can unlock and

enter into vehicle by using mechanical key

blade. Present inside the smart key. Refer

‘Starting and Driving’ section for more

information.

Key blade in / out

Slide the knob (1) to unlatch the key. Pull the key

blade (2) out.

Smart Key Features

Vehicle search

ln vehicle locked condition if lock button on remote

key is pressed the turn indicators of vehicle flashes

4 times.

Automatic activation of immobilizer

If smart key will not found within the passenger

compartment, engine will be immobilized and

vehicle cannot be start.

Auto locking / unlocking of doors / auto relock

ln case of PEPS variants, door will get unlocked

when ignition is OFF by pressing Start Stop switch.

Anti-grab / anti-scan coding

The remote control set of this security system is

protected against the use of devices called

‘scanners’ and ‘grabbers’ which can record and

reproduce some types of remote codes.
